This investigation into spree killing analyses the psychology of this chilling and relatively new phenomenon. Cawthorne carefully examines each case and shows how the killers suppress their rage and violent fantasies until a small incident sparks off their fatal rampage.The cases include that of Michael Ryan, who slew sixteen in the quiet English town of Hungerford; Wade Frankum, who went berserk with a rifle in a shopping plaza in Sydney, Australia; teenage students Eric Harris and Dylan Klebold and their killing spree at Columbine High School in Colorado, USA; Seung-Hui Cho, responsible for the Virginia Tech massacre, the deadliest shooting frenzy by a single gunman in the history of the USA; and the incident with Isaac Zamora in Mount Vernon, Washington State.

About the Author:
Nigel Cawthorne is the author of House of Horrors: The Horrific True Story of Josef Fritzl, The Father From Hell; The World's Greatest Serial Killers and Killers: The Most Barbaric Murderers of Our Times. He is also known for his best-selling Sex Lives series which includes Sex Lives of the Kings and Queens of England, and over sixty other books.
